Lessons learned from this season's conference title game participants
Bill Barnwell, ESPN writer known for data-driven league analysis, and Nate Tice, Yahoo film-focused analyst, break down what made this season's final four teams click. They discuss explosive-play differential, field-position and special-teams swings, tight ends who block, interior defensive line importance, formation tactics like empty/base to force coverage, and multiple roster paths to winning.

The players and coaches defining the 2025 NFL season
Nate Tice, an insightful NFL analyst known for his sharp football analysis, joins Robert Mays to discuss pivotal players and coaches shaping the 2025 season. They delve into the Buffalo Bills' tight-end evolution and how versatile rookies are transforming offensive strategies. Tice highlights the Bears' explosive offense driven by innovative scheming, alongside the Broncos' defensive powerhouse, Noah Hufanga. The duo also examines the revival of under-center plays and the growing value of second-chance quarterbacks, providing deep insights into the league's evolving landscape.
